>> My client has a requirement for XHTML 1.0 Strict compliance in their OFBiz
>> implementatoin.  I've been hunting around and discovered that the DOCTYPE is
>> set in the class org.ofbiz.widget.html.HtmlScreenRenderer in the
>> renderScreenBegin() method.   Now I could simply change the line of code or
>> extend HtmlScreenRenderer, but I was thinking that it might be better to
>> have this setting in a configuration file somewhere instead (perhaps in
>> common/config/general.properties?).  I would be interested to hear your
>> thoughts.
